Ingredients You’ll Need
Each ingredient in this Buffalo Hummus with Blue Cheese Crumbles Recipe plays a vital role, from providing the creamy foundation to delivering that signature tangy heat and finishing with a fresh, vibrant touch. These ingredients are straightforward, yet come together beautifully to create something truly special.
- 1 can (15 oz) chickpeas: The creamy base of your hummus, packed with protein and fiber.
- 1/4 cup buffalo sauce: Adds the classic spicy flavor that defines the dish; adjust to taste for heat preference.
- 3 tablespoons tahini: A rich sesame paste that gives the hummus its smooth texture and nutty undertone.
- 2 cloves garlic, chopped: Infuses the hummus with bold, savory depth.
- 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ice: Brings bright acidity to balance the richness and spice.
- 2 tablespoons olive oil: Ensures a silky finish and helps blend all flavors seamlessly.
- Salt, to taste: Enhances all the individual flavors just right.
- Black pepper, to taste: Adds a gentle kick and rounds out the seasoning.
- Blue cheese crumbles: Sprinkled on top for that luxurious, tangy contrast and texture.
- Drizzle of olive oil: A final touch to enrich and glam up the presentation.
- Freshly chopped herbs (e.g., chives or parsley): For a pop of color and fresh herbal aroma.
How to Make Buffalo Hummus with Blue Cheese Crumbles Recipe
Step 1: Gather and Prep Ingredients
Start by draining and rinsing your chickpeas to wash away any excess salt or canning liquids—this keeps the flavor bright and clean. Chop the garlic finely and have your buffalo sauce, tahini, and fresh lemon juice ready to go; prepping everything upfront makes the blending process smooth and quick.
Step 2: Blend the Base
Into your food processor, add the chickpeas, tahini, chopped garlic, fresh lemon juice, and olive oil. Blend until the mixture is smooth and creamy, stopping occasionally to scrape down the sides so every bit gets fully pureed. This step creates that luscious hummus consistency you crave.
Step 3: Add the Buffalo Sauce
Gradually pour in the buffalo sauce while pulsing the food processor, ensuring the flavor disperses evenly throughout the hummus. Keep tasting as you go to dial in the perfect amount of spice and color that excites your palate.
Step 4: Season and Adjust
Give your hummus a taste test and adjust the seasoning with salt, a dash of black pepper, or more lemon juice if it needs a bit more brightness. If the hummus feels too thick, a drizzle of olive oil or a splash of water will help loosen it up, making it perfect for dipping.
Step 5: Serve and Garnish
Transfer the hummus into a serving bowl and crown it with generous blue cheese crumbles for a delightful tang. Add a light drizzle of olive oil and sprinkle freshly chopped herbs like chives or parsley on top to bring freshness and an inviting pop of green. Serve immediately, or chill for an hour to let the flavors meld beautifully.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Store any leftover Buffalo Hummus in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. This helps preserve the fresh flavors and creamy texture, so you can enjoy it again without sacrificing taste.
Freezing
While you can freeze hummus, keep in mind that the texture may slightly change upon thawing. If you choose to freeze, do so in a sealed container for up to one month. Thaw overnight in the fridge and stir well before serving.
Reheating
This hummus tastes best cold or at room temperature, so reheating is usually unnecessary. If you prefer it warmer, let it sit at room temperature for a bit or gently warm it in short bursts in the microwave, stirring in between to keep it smooth.
FAQs
Can I make Buffalo Hummus with Blue Cheese Crumbles Recipe vegan?
You can easily make the hummus vegan by omitting the blue cheese crumbles or using a plant-based blue cheese alternative, keeping all the rest of the flavors intact.
How spicy is the Buffalo Hummus with Blue Cheese Crumbles Recipe?
The level of heat depends on how much buffalo sauce you add; start with a quarter cup and adjust upward if you like it hotter, or reduce if you prefer a milder taste.
What can I use if I don’t have tahini?
If tahini is not on hand, you can substitute it with peanut butter or almond butter for a different but delicious nutty flavor, although it will slightly alter the traditional taste.
Is fresh garlic better than garlic powder for this recipe?
Fresh garlic gives a more vibrant, pungent flavor which complements the hummus beautifully; garlic powder can be used if necessary but won’t provide quite the same fresh kick.
Can I prepare this Buffalo Hummus ahead of time?
Absolutely! Make the hummus a day in advance and chill it in the fridge to let the flavors develop even more intensely. Just add the blue cheese topping right before serving for maximum freshness.

Buffalo Hummus with Blue Cheese Crumbles Recipe
- Prep Time: 5 minutes
- Cook Time: 5 minutes
- Total Time: 10 minutes
- Yield: 2 servings
- Category: Appetizer
- Method: Blending
- Cuisine: American
Description
A spicy and flavorful twist on classic hummus, Buffalo Hummus combines creamy chickpeas with tangy buffalo sauce for a perfect appetizer or snack. Garnished with blue cheese crumbles and fresh herbs, this quick 10-minute recipe delivers bold taste with a smooth texture.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 1 can (15 oz) chickpeas, drained and rinsed
- 1/4 cup buffalo sauce (adjust to taste)
- 3 tablespoons tahini
- 2 cloves garlic, chopped
- 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Salt, to taste
- Black pepper, to taste
Garnish
- Blue cheese crumbles
- Drizzle of olive oil
- Freshly chopped herbs (e.g., chives or parsley)
Instructions
- Gather and prep ingredients: Prepare all ingredients by draining and rinsing the chickpeas, chopping the garlic, and measuring out the buffalo sauce, tahini, lemon juice, and olive oil to ensure smooth blending.
- Drain and rinse chickpeas: Thoroughly rinse the canned chickpeas under cold water to remove any excess salt or canning liquid, which helps improve the flavor and texture of the hummus.
- Blend the base: In a food processor, combine chickpeas, tahini, chopped garlic, lemon juice, and olive oil. Blend until the mixture is smooth and creamy, stopping occasionally to scrape down the sides for even consistency.
- Add the buffalo sauce: Gradually pour in the buffalo sauce while pulsing the food processor to incorporate evenly. Continue blending until the hummus achieves your desired spice level and color.
- Season and adjust: Taste the hummus and add salt, black pepper, or more lemon juice as needed to balance the flavors. If the hummus is too thick, add a small amount of water or olive oil to loosen the texture.
- Serve and garnish: Transfer the finished buffalo hummus to a bowl. Top with blue cheese crumbles, drizzle with olive oil, and sprinkle freshly chopped herbs like chives or parsley for extra flavor and presentation. Serve immediately or chill for an hour to enhance the flavors.
Notes
- Adjust the amount of buffalo sauce according to your preferred spice level.
- For a smoother texture, peel the chickpeas before blending.
- This recipe can be made vegan by omitting the blue cheese garnish or substituting with a vegan alternative.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
- Serve with fresh vegetables, pita chips, or crackers for a delicious appetizer.
